# Bitwarden Directory Connector
## Project Overview
@@ -24,392 +20,6 @@ Directory Connector is a TypeScript application that synchronizes users and grou
- Node
- Jest for testing
### Current Project Status
**Mission Critical but Deprioritized:** Directory Connector is used to sync customer directory services with their Bitwarden organization. While SCIM is the more modern cloud-hosted solution, not all directory services support SCIM, and SCIM is only available on Enterprise plans. Therefore, DC remains mission-critical infrastructure for many paying customers, but it's deprioritized in the codebase due to infrequent changes.
**Isolated Repository:** Unlike other Bitwarden client applications that live in a monorepo with shared core libraries, Directory Connector was kept separate when other TypeScript clients moved to the monorepo. It got its own copy of the jslib repo to avoid unnecessary regressions from apparently unrelated code changes in other clients. This severed it from the rest of the codebase, causing:
- Outdated dependencies that can't be updated (ES modules vs CommonJS conflicts)
- File/folder structure that doesn't match modern Bitwarden client patterns
- Accumulated technical debt requiring significant investment to pay down
- jslib contains unused code from all clients, but cannot be deleted due to monolithic/tightly coupled architecture
**Critical Issues (Current Status):**
-~~Electron, Node, and Angular are on unmaintained versions~~ **RESOLVED** - All updated (Electron 39, Node 20, Angular 21, TypeScript 5.9)
-`keytar` is archived (Dec 2022) and incompatible with Node v22, **blocking Node upgrades beyond v20** - **PRIMARY BLOCKER**
- ❌ No ESM support blocks dependency upgrades: googleapis, lowdb, chalk, inquirer, node-fetch, electron-store
- ⚠️ 70 dev dependencies + 31 runtime dependencies = excessive maintenance burden (count increased with Angular 21 tooling)
- ❌ StateService is a large pre-StateProvider monolith containing every getter/setter for all clients (PM-31159 In Progress)
-~~Angular CLI not used~~ **RESOLVED** - Angular CLI 21.1.2 now integrated with angular.json configuration
**Development Approach:** When working on this codebase, prioritize sustainability and maintainability over adding new features. Consider how changes will affect long-term maintenance burden.

### Phase 4: Replace Keytar (PM-12436, To Do) ⚠️ **CRITICAL BLOCKER**
**Problem:** `keytar` (OS secure storage for secrets) was archived December 2022 and is incompatible with Node v22, **actively blocking Node upgrades beyond v20**.
**Current Status:**
- `keytar`: **7.9.0** (still present in dependencies)
- **This is the #1 blocker preventing Node v22+ upgrades**
- All "Immediate Priority" dependencies have been upgraded, but further progress requires removing keytar
**Solution:** Migrate to Bitwarden's Rust implementation in `desktop_native` (same as clients monorepo did)
1. Implement Rust <-> NAPI integration (like `desktop_native/napi`) from Electron app to Rust code
2. Copy, rename, and expose necessary functions
3. Point to `desktop_native` crate using git link from DC repo (no need for SDK yet):
```rust
desktop_core = { git = "https://github.com/bitwarden/clients", rev = "00cf24972d944638bbd1adc00a0ae3eeabb6eb9a" }
```
**Important:** `keytar` uses wrong encoding on Windows (UTF-8 instead of UTF-16). Bitwarden uses UTF-16. Code should contain a migration - ensure old values are migrated correctly during testing.
**Priority:** This should be prioritized as it's blocking the Node upgrade path and has been archived for over 2 years.

# CommonJS to ESM Conversion
Convert a file (or files) from CommonJS module syntax to ECMAScript Modules (ESM).
## Usage
```
/commonjs-to-esm <file-path> [additional-file-paths...]
```
## Parameters
- `file-path` - Path to the file(s) to convert from CommonJS to ESM
## Examples
```
/commonjs-to-esm src/services/auth.service.ts
/commonjs-to-esm src/utils/helper.ts src/utils/parser.ts
```
## Process
This skill performs a comprehensive analysis and planning process:
### 1. Analyze Target File(s)
For each file to convert:
- Read the file contents
- Identify its purpose and functionality
- Catalog all CommonJS patterns used:
- `require()` statements
- `module.exports` assignments
- `exports.x = ...` assignments
- Dynamic requires
- `__dirname` and `__filename` usage
### 2. Find Dependents
- Search for all files that import/require the target file(s)
- Identify the import patterns used by dependents
- Map the dependency tree to understand impact scope
### 3. Analyze Dependencies
- List all modules the target file(s) depend on
- Determine if dependencies support ESM
- Identify potential blocking dependencies (CommonJS-only packages)
- Check for dynamic imports that may need special handling
### 4. Identify Conversion Challenges
Common issues to flag:
- `__dirname` and `__filename` (need `import.meta.url` conversion)
- Dynamic `require()` calls (need `import()` conversion)
- Conditional requires (need refactoring)
- JSON imports (need `assert { type: 'json' }`)
- CommonJS-only dependencies (may block conversion)
- Circular dependencies (may need restructuring)
### 5. Generate Conversion Plan
Create a step-by-step plan that includes:
**Target File Changes:**
- Convert `require()` to `import` statements
- Convert `module.exports` to `export` statements
- Update `__dirname`/`__filename` to use `import.meta.url`
- Handle dynamic imports appropriately
- Update file extensions if needed (e.g., `.js` to `.mjs`)
**Dependent File Changes:**
- Update all import statements in dependent files
- Ensure consistent naming (default vs named exports)
- Update path references if extensions change
**Configuration Changes:**
- `package.json`: Add `"type": "module"` or use `.mjs` extension
- `tsconfig.json`: Update `module` and `moduleResolution` settings
- Build tools: Update bundler/compiler configurations
**Testing Strategy:**
- Run unit tests after conversion
- Verify no runtime errors from import changes
- Check that all exports are accessible
- Test dynamic import scenarios
### 6. Risk Assessment
Evaluate:
- Number of files affected
- Complexity of CommonJS patterns used
- Presence of blocking dependencies
- Potential for breaking changes
### 7. Present Plan
Output a structured plan with:
- Summary of changes needed
- Ordered steps for execution
- List of files to modify
- Configuration changes required
- Testing checkpoints
- Risk factors and mitigation strategies
- Estimated scope (small/medium/large change)
## Notes
- ESM is **not** compatible with CommonJS in all cases - ESM can import CommonJS, but CommonJS **cannot** require ESM
- This means conversions should generally proceed from leaf dependencies upward
- Some packages remain CommonJS-only and may block full conversion
- The skill generates a plan but does NOT automatically execute the conversion - review and approve first

# Google Workspace Directory Integration
This document provides technical documentation for the Google Workspace (formerly G Suite) directory integration in Bitwarden Directory Connector.
## Overview
The Google Workspace integration synchronizes users and groups from Google Workspace to Bitwarden organizations using the Google Admin SDK Directory API. The service uses a service account with domain-wide delegation to authenticate and access directory data.
## Architecture
### Service Location
- **Implementation**: `src/services/directory-services/gsuite-directory.service.ts`
- **Configuration Model**: `src/models/gsuiteConfiguration.ts`
- **Integration Tests**: `src/services/directory-services/gsuite-directory.service.integration.spec.ts`
### Authentication Flow
The Google Workspace integration uses **OAuth 2.0 with Service Accounts** and domain-wide delegation:
1. A service account is created in Google Cloud Console
2. The service account is granted domain-wide delegation authority
3. The service account is authorized for specific OAuth scopes in Google Workspace Admin Console
4. The Directory Connector uses the service account's private key to generate JWT tokens
5. JWT tokens are exchanged for access tokens to call the Admin SDK APIs
### Required OAuth Scopes
The service account must be granted the following OAuth 2.0 scopes:
```
https://www.googleapis.com/auth/admin.directory.user.readonly
https://www.googleapis.com/auth/admin.directory.group.readonly
https://www.googleapis.com/auth/admin.directory.group.member.readonly
```
## Configuration
### Required Fields
| Field | Description |
| ------------- | --------------------------------------------------------------------------------------- |
| `clientEmail` | Service account email address (e.g., `service-account@project.iam.gserviceaccount.com`) |
| `privateKey` | Service account private key in PEM format |
| `adminUser` | Admin user email to impersonate for domain-wide delegation |
| `domain` | Primary domain of the Google Workspace organization |
### Optional Fields
| Field | Description |
| ---------- | ---------------------------------------------------------- |
| `customer` | Customer ID for multi-domain organizations (rarely needed) |
### Example Configuration
```typescript
{
clientEmail: "directory-connector@my-project.iam.gserviceaccount.com",
privateKey: "-----BEGIN PRIVATE KEY-----\n...\n-----END PRIVATE KEY-----\n",
adminUser: "admin@example.com",
domain: "example.com",
customer: "" // Usually not required
}
```
## Setup Instructions
### 1. Create a Service Account
1. Go to [Google Cloud Console](https://console.cloud.google.com)
2. Create or select a project
3. Navigate to **IAM & Admin** > **Service Accounts**
4. Click **Create Service Account**
5. Enter a name and description
6. Click **Create and Continue**
7. Skip granting roles (not needed for this use case)
8. Click **Done**
### 2. Generate Service Account Key
1. Click on the newly created service account
2. Navigate to the **Keys** tab
3. Click **Add Key** > **Create new key**
4. Select **JSON** format
5. Click **Create** and download the key file
6. Extract `client_email` and `private_key` from the JSON file
### 3. Enable Domain-Wide Delegation
1. In the service account details, click **Show Advanced Settings**
2. Under **Domain-wide delegation**, click **Enable Google Workspace Domain-wide Delegation**
3. Note the **Client ID** (numeric ID)
### 4. Authorize the Service Account in Google Workspace
1. Go to [Google Workspace Admin Console](https://admin.google.com)
2. Navigate to **Security** > **API Controls** > **Domain-wide Delegation**
3. Click **Add new**
4. Enter the **Client ID** from step 3
5. Enter the following OAuth scopes (comma-separated):
```
https://www.googleapis.com/auth/admin.directory.user.readonly,
https://www.googleapis.com/auth/admin.directory.group.readonly,
https://www.googleapis.com/auth/admin.directory.group.member.readonly
```
6. Click **Authorize**
### 5. Configure Directory Connector
Use the extracted values to configure the Directory Connector:
- **Client Email**: From `client_email` in the JSON key file
- **Private Key**: From `private_key` in the JSON key file (keep the `\n` line breaks)
- **Admin User**: Email of a super admin user in your Google Workspace domain
- **Domain**: Your primary Google Workspace domain
## Sync Behavior
### User Synchronization
The service synchronizes the following user attributes:
| Google Workspace Field | Bitwarden Field | Notes |
| ------------------------- | --------------------------- | ----------------------------------------- |
| `id` | `referenceId`, `externalId` | User's unique Google ID |
| `primaryEmail` | `email` | Normalized to lowercase |
| `suspended` OR `archived` | `disabled` | User is disabled if suspended or archived |
| Deleted status | `deleted` | Set to true for deleted users |
**Special Behavior:**
- The service queries both **active users** and **deleted users** separately
- Suspended and archived users are included but marked as disabled
- Deleted users are included with the `deleted` flag set to true
### Group Synchronization
The service synchronizes the following group attributes:
| Google Workspace Field | Bitwarden Field | Notes |
| ----------------------- | --------------------------- | ------------------------ |
| `id` | `referenceId`, `externalId` | Group's unique Google ID |
| `name` | `name` | Group display name |
| Members (type=USER) | `userMemberExternalIds` | Individual user members |
| Members (type=GROUP) | `groupMemberReferenceIds` | Nested group members |
| Members (type=CUSTOMER) | `userMemberExternalIds` | All domain users |
**Member Types:**
- **USER**: Individual user accounts (only ACTIVE status users are synced)
- **GROUP**: Nested groups (allows group hierarchy)
- **CUSTOMER**: Special member type that includes all users in the domain
### Filtering
#### User Filter Examples
```
exclude:testuser1@bwrox.dev | testuser1@bwrox.dev # Exclude multiple users
|orgUnitPath='/Integration testing' # Users in Integration testing Organizational unit (OU)
exclude:testuser1@bwrox.dev | orgUnitPath='/Integration testing' # Combined filter: get users in OU excluding provided user
|email:testuser* # Users with email starting with "testuser"
```
#### Group Filter Examples
An important note for group filters is that it implicitly only syncs users that are in groups. For example, in the case of
the integration test data, `admin@bwrox.dev` is not a member of any group. Therefore, the first example filter below will
also implicitly exclude `admin@bwrox.dev`, who is not in any group. This is important because when it is paired with an
empty user filter, this query may semantically be understood as "sync everyone not in Integration Test Group A," while in
practice it means "Only sync members of groups not in integration Test Groups A."
```
exclude:Integration Test Group A # Get all users in groups excluding the provided group.
```
### User AND Group Filter Examples
```
```
**Filter Syntax:**
- Prefix with `|` for custom filters
- Use `:` for pattern matching (supports `*` wildcard)
- Combine multiple conditions with spaces (AND logic)
### Pagination
The service automatically handles pagination for all API calls:
- Users API (active and deleted)
- Groups API
- Group Members API
Each API call processes all pages using the `nextPageToken` mechanism until no more results are available.
## Error Handling
### Common Errors
| Error | Cause | Resolution |
| ---------------------- | ------------------------------------- | ---------------------------------------------------------- |
| "dirConfigIncomplete" | Missing required configuration fields | Verify all required fields are provided |
| "authenticationFailed" | Invalid credentials or unauthorized | Check service account key and domain-wide delegation setup |
| API returns 401/403 | Missing OAuth scopes | Verify scopes are authorized in Admin Console |
| API returns 404 | Invalid domain or customer ID | Check domain configuration |
### Security Considerations
The service implements the following security measures:
1. **Credential sanitization**: Error messages do not expose private keys or sensitive credentials
2. **Secure authentication**: Uses OAuth 2.0 with JWT tokens, not API keys
3. **Read-only access**: Only requires read-only scopes for directory data
4. **No credential logging**: Service account credentials are not logged
